On one side of this little ball locket is a Roman numeral clock, and on the other, a compass. The details are painted in pure black and white with a tiny brush & lots of concentration. The background is a rich, glossy oil enamel in a shade of deep steel blue.
The locket is antique, spherical, and may be worn open or closed. Diameter measures slightly less than a penny (think of a marble). Each locket comes from vintage stock and has its own bit of natural tarnish.
The chain is raw brass, measures approximately 20" and will darken to a vintage patina over time. Closed with a lobster clasp.
